So, this is just a <br />snap shot of the species we have been discussing over the past <br />several months. <br />So, we had our whole series of scoping meetings as I have <br />mentioned, starting from November all the way to December last <br />year across the State, so each district office, held 2 scoping session <br />for the public. We had a total of 196 participants across these <br />session, 200 written comments. So, there is a lot information and a <br />lot of feedback that we received so in this process of compiling all of <br />this and summarizing it and hopefully presenting that and sharing <br />that back to the public. We initially wanted to do that, earlier in the <br />year, but, we also, had our 30/30 core team we actually held a bunch <br />of focus group sessions and received a lot of feedback, from those as <br />well, so it kind of pushed everything back because, we wanted to <br />include all of that and the feedback as well and we are going to <br />sharing it back and we are planning for our next round of scoping this <br />June, just to share back and also to incorporate and address all the <br />issues and concerns and the oppositions you know what we are <br />proposing and share and propose some revised rules and strategies <br />based on what we gathered and input we received.
